Known Imperial deep fryer weak points
- standing-pilot and thermocouple failures preventing burner ignition
- burner valve and orifice wear causing weak or uneven flame
- oven and fryer thermostat drift affecting temperature accuracy
- griddle plate warping and thermostat faults over heavy use
Quick check — and when it's not DIY
Worth checking yourself first: feel whether the exterior housing itself is hotter than usual, not just the interior, which points to a ventilation or fan problem. Past that point, if it still overheats with clear airflow, a thermostat, sensor, or fan has failed, and running it further risks a real fire hazard — this is where to stop and call.
